Custom Query Blocks

Map your archives to pages. Map 404 and term archives as well.

v5.6.0Ronald HuerecaUpdated Added 800 installs92% rating
98
Score
6
Errors
13
Warnings
+0
Change

Category Scores

Security100
Repo100
Performance100
Maintainability89

Issues to Review

Prioritized issue groups from the latest Plugin Check scan

19 findings

Maintainability

14

4 issue groups

I18n

5

3 issue groups

WARNINGMaintainabilityNon-prefixed hook nameHook names invoked by a theme/plugin should start with the theme/plugin prefix. Found: "post_type_archive_title".8
Category
Maintainability
Occurrences
8
Severity
warning

Sample message

Hook names invoked by a theme/plugin should start with the theme/plugin prefix. Found: "post_type_archive_title".

WARNINGMaintainabilityDynamic hook nameHook names invoked by a theme/plugin should start with the theme/plugin prefix. Found: "$action".3
Category
Maintainability
Occurrences
3
Severity
warning

Sample message

Hook names invoked by a theme/plugin should start with the theme/plugin prefix. Found: "$action".

ERRORI18nMissing Arg DomainMissing $domain parameter in function call to __().2
Category
I18n
Occurrences
2
Severity
error

Sample message

Missing $domain parameter in function call to __().

ERRORI18nText Domain MismatchMismatched text domain. Expected 'post-type-archive-mapping' but got 'dlx-ratings-nag'.2
Category
I18n
Occurrences
2
Severity
error

Sample message

Mismatched text domain. Expected 'post-type-archive-mapping' but got 'dlx-ratings-nag'.

ERRORMaintainabilityMissing direct file access protectionPHP file should prevent direct access. Add a check like: if ( ! defined( 'ABSPATH' ) ) exit;2
Category
Maintainability
Occurrences
2
Severity
error

Sample message

PHP file should prevent direct access. Add a check like: if ( ! defined( 'ABSPATH' ) ) exit;

WARNINGI18nDiscouraged text-domain loadingload_plugin_textdomain() has been discouraged since WordPress version 4.6. When your plugin is hosted on WordPress.org, you no longer need to manually include this function call for translations under your plugin slug. WordPress will automatically load the translations for you as needed.1
Category
I18n
Occurrences
1
Severity
warning

Sample message

load_plugin_textdomain() has been discouraged since WordPress version 4.6. When your plugin is hosted on WordPress.org, you no longer need to manually include this function call for translations under your plugin slug. WordPress will automatically load the translations for you as needed.

WARNINGMaintainabilityNon-prefixed classClasses declared by a theme/plugin should start with the theme/plugin prefix. Found: "PostTypeArchiveMapping".1
Category
Maintainability
Occurrences
1
Severity
warning

Sample message

Classes declared by a theme/plugin should start with the theme/plugin prefix. Found: "PostTypeArchiveMapping".

External Connections

Potential connections found in static code analysis.

8 domains

Outbound calls

22

External assets

0

Incoming endpoints

8

Notable Domains

mediaron.com5 · outbound
dlxplugins.com2 · outbound
schemas.wp.org1 · outbound

Platform / Reference Domains

w3.org6 · platform/reference
github.com4 · platform/reference
wordpress.org2 · platform/reference
core.trac.wordpress.org1 · platform/reference
gnu.org1 · platform/reference

External Asset Domains

No external asset domains detected.

Incoming Endpoints

/wp-json/ptam/v2/get_featured_postsREST

register_rest_route

/wp-json/ptam/v2/get_imagesREST

register_rest_route

/wp-json/ptam/v2/get_postsREST

register_rest_route

/wp-json/ptam/v2/get_tax_term_dataREST

register_rest_route

/wp-json/ptam/v2/get_tax_termsREST

register_rest_route

/wp-json/ptam/v2/get_taxonomiesREST

register_rest_route

Admin AJAX endpoints1
wp_ajax_ptam_dismiss_noticeauthenticated

wp_ajax

Score History

First score snapshot

v5.6.0

98

Latest

Findings
19
Errors
6
Warnings
13
Check
2.0.0

Relationship Map

Author, categories, issues, domains, and nearby plugins.

31 nodes

Related Plugins

Archive Page

700 active installs

100
Category Archives Block

900 active installs

98
Clean My Archives

800 active installs

98
Tainacan Extra View Modes

400 active installs

98
Disable Author Archives

10k+ active installs

96
Advanced Posts/Page

3k+ active installs

91